Nutrient Comparison: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t VS Frozen Broccoli Spears per 1 lb
Compare the macro and micronutrient content in 1 lb of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t versus 1 lb of Frozen Broccoli Spears to make informed dietary choices. Explore their nutritional differences and benefits.
Lets compare vitamin content per 1 pound of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t vs Frozen Broccoli Spears:
- 1 pound of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t has 6.6 times more Vitamin B1, 3 times more Vitamin B2, 8.6 times more Vitamin B3 and 1.6 times more Vitamin B5 than Frozen Broccoli Spears.
- While 1 lb of Frozen Broccoli Spears contains more Vitamin A, 2.7 times more Vitamin B6, more Vitamin C, 6.1 times more Vitamin E and 32.7 times more Vitamin K than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t.
- Both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t and Frozen Broccoli Spears provide similar amounts of Vitamin B9 per one pound.
- 1 pound of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in C and Vitamin E
- Both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t as well as Frozen Broccoli Spears have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in one pound.
Comparing minerals per 1 pound for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t vs Frozen Broccoli Spears:
- 1 pound of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t has 2.6 times more Calcium, 3.5 times more Copper, 4.2 times more Iron, 1.5 times more Magnesium, 1.5 times more Manganese, 1.6 times more Phosphorus, 11.9 times more Selenium, 17.5 times more Sodium and 1.8 times more Zinc than Frozen Broccoli Spears.
- While 1 lb of Frozen Broccoli Spears contains 2.1 times more Potassium and 2.5 times more Water than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 1 pound:
- 1 pound of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t has 9.2 times more Energy, 10.6 times more Fat, 15.6 times more Saturated Fat, 19.2 times more Omega 6, 9.3 times more Carbohydrate, 2.9 times more Sugars and 2.7 times more Protein than Frozen Broccoli Spears.
- While 1 lb of Frozen Broccoli Spears contains 3.6 times more Omega 3 and 1.3 times more Fiber than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t.
